Draft Order Determination
The intricate dance of win-loss records and the strength of schedule as a tiebreaker is at the heart of determining the 2025 draft order. Teams across the league now take a reflective stance, poised to analyze their season performances and identify areas where improvement is paramount. For franchises like the Titans, with key free agents such as Safety Quandre Diggs and Wide Receiver Tyler Boyd, the potential loss of talent looms large.
Similarly, the Cleveland Browns are anticipating decisions about linchpins like Offensive Tackle Jedrick Wills and Running Back Nick Chubb, who head into free agency. These potential departures underscore the importance of shrewd drafting and free-agent acquisitions.
Key Free Agency Concerns
The Giants face a comparable scenario, with key players like Wide Receiver Darius Slayton and Quarterback Drew Lock potentially exiting. For teams like the Patriots and Jaguars, the imminent movement of stars such as Cornerback Jonathan Jones and Quarterback Mac Jones respectively, poses strategic considerations heading into the draft.
Strategically enhancing rosters is top of mind for teams such as the Jets, Raiders, and Panthers, with a focus on bolstering offensive tackle and wide receiver positions. On a similar note, the Cardinals, Bears, and 49ers are set to emphasize depth and talent in both defensive and offensive line positions, aiming to fortify their lines against the competition.
